About Skyline Champion

Champion Homes Inc is a factory-built housing company in North America. The company is well positioned with an portfolio of manufactured and modular homes, ADUs, park-models and modular buildings for the single-family, multi-family, and other hospitality sectors. In addition to its core home building business, the company provides construction services to install and set-up factory-built homes, operates a factory-direct retail business across the United States, and operates Star Fleet Trucking, providing transportation services to the manufactured housing and other industries from several locations across the US. The Company has two reportable segment U.S. Factory-built Housing and Canadian Factory-built Housing. The majority of the revenue is generated from U.S. Factory-built Housing.

Bulls say / Bears say

For fiscal year 2026, net sales increased 7.3% to $2.7 billion while adjusted net income rose 6.2% to $217.4 million, reflecting resilient performance amid a challenging housing market (Investing.com).
Champion beat Q4 FY26 expectations with revenues of $621.3 million (up 4.6% YoY) surpassing the $607.4 million consensus and adjusted EPS of $0.68 beating by $0.06, underscoring strong pricing power and operational execution (Investing.com).
The acquisition of 11 Homes Direct retail locations expands Champion’s factory-direct retail footprint in key Western U.S. markets, diversifying sales channels and enhancing its direct-to-consumer strategy (Investing.com).
Despite revenue growth, gross margin contracted to 26.2% due to higher material costs, keeping investors cautious about margin durability (Investing.com).
First quarter fiscal 2027 net sales grew only 1.3% YoY to $710.2 million, signaling subdued demand as it nears full-year guidance and raising concerns over growth momentum (Reuters).
RBC Capital reduced its fiscal 2027 adjusted EBITDA estimate by 8%, reflecting analyst skepticism around margin recovery and revenue outlook (Investing.com).
